11:26
Expected On time
Shrewsbury
Calling at:
- Wrenbury (11:33)
- Whitchurch (Shropshire) (11:41)
- Prees (11:48)
- Wem (11:53)
- Yorton (11:59)
- Shrewsbury (12:12)
12:17
Expected On time
Milford Haven
Calling at:
- Whitchurch (Shropshire) (12:27)
- Shrewsbury (12:45)
- Church Stretton (13:00)
- Craven Arms (13:08)
- Ludlow (13:16)
- Leominster (13:27)
- Hereford (13:42)
- Abergavenny (14:04)
- Cwmbran (14:16)
- Newport (South Wales) (14:30)
- Cardiff Central (14:44)
- Bridgend (15:06)
- Port Talbot Parkway (15:17)
- Neath (15:24)
- Swansea (15:40)
- Gowerton (15:54)
- Llanelli (16:00)
- Pembrey & Burry Port (16:06)
- Kidwelly (16:13)
- Ferryside (16:19)
- Carmarthen (16:32)
- Whitland (16:49)
- Clunderwen (16:56)
- Clarbeston Road (17:03)
- Haverfordwest (17:12)
- Johnston (17:20)
- Milford Haven (17:31)
12:20
Expected 12:33
Manchester Piccadilly
Calling at:
- Crewe (12:39)
- Wilmslow (12:58)
- Stockport (13:06)
- Manchester Piccadilly (13:15)
This service has been delayed by a fault on this train which is now fixed
13:00
Expected On time
Crewe